Shaw Names Grant Women's Flag Football Coach - Shaw University RALEIGH, N.C. — Shaw University Athletics announced Thursday the hiring of Bacchus Grant as the first head coach in program history for the university's newly established women's flag football program.

Durham Association of Educators (DAE), the labor union for Durham Public School workers, hosted its first public living wage town hall at NorthStar Church of the Arts.
There, classified staff took turns sharing their experiences serving Durham public school students while also trying to keep up with the increasing cost of living. Classified staff includes instructional assistants, custodians, cafeteria workers and bus drivers.
“A 12% wage doesn’t even bring us up to where we need to be,” Parkstone said. While DPS bus drivers’ wages range between $19.43 and a maximum of $28 per hour after 30 years of service, GoTriangle offers a starting wage of $22.68 plus bonuses. A DPS custodian can earn a maximum $20.95 per hour after 30 years, compared to a city or county custodian’s hourly starting wage of $21.90. “The county is already paying their workers more than what we’re making, which makes our jobs less desirable,” Parkstone said.
Durham County Manager Claudia Hager proposed a county budget May 11, most notably an additional $10.9 million for DPS, “which covers continuation costs that have risen with inflation,” according to DAE President and DPS high school science teacher Mika Tweitmeyer. The budget proposal didn’t include that $14.8 million requested by DAE from meetings with the union and county staff, which would include the 12% wage increase for classified staff. That requested raise would increase the wage to $19.22 per hour.
